Duties and Role:
Under the direction of the Senior Engineer, the incumbent will perform duties such as the following:
Provide expert engineering support NATO's Deployable CIS Reference Systems. Technical support will include design, test, implementation, deployment and support of new IT baselines, provide specialized troubleshooting and explore new technologies, in the areas of Networking, Infrastructure, Platform, Authentication, Web hosting, cyber hygiene and Remote Desktop solutions.
Prepare, install and maintain the local Integration Hub Laboratory named "MARS" (Mission Agnostic Reference Systems), which hosts the NIMSC Reference Systems;
Perform the testing activities in the Integration Hub for testing new Baselines, new software and hardware versions or Models;
Prepare Test Cases for Equipment Under Test;
Execute Tests and write Reports;
Maintain documentation and configuration baselines for the Integration Hub.
Contribute and participate in a Development-Operations (DevOps) environment using concepts like continuous integration, continuous change management, deployment automation and system monitoring.
Document designs and implementations of assigned services as well as troubleshooting guides
